School Profile: Vaughn School

Welcome to the school profile for Vaughn School! Looking for local school information?

Vaughn School is located at 55260 County Road 21, Stockton, AL 36579. The contact phone number is (251) 937-4592. It has a student/teacher ratio of 14.44.

  • School District: Baldwin County
  • Grade Range: KG - 5
  • Students: 130
  • Teachers (FTE): 9
  • Student/Teacher Ratio: 14.44
  • Title I eligible: Yes
